Java版吃豆游戲及源碼

編輯:關於JAVA

這是一個吃豆游戲的Java實現,具體代碼較多請下載文件。

package org.loon.test;
import java.awt.Color;
import java.awt.Event;
import java.awt.Frame;
import java.awt.Graphics;
import java.awt.Image;
import java.awt.Insets;
import java.awt.MediaTracker;
import java.awt.Panel;
import java.awt.Toolkit;
import java.awt.event.WindowAdapter;
import java.awt.event.WindowEvent;
import java.awt.image.BufferedImage;
import java.awt.image.VolatileImage;
/**
*
* <p>
* Title: LoonFramework
* </p>
* <p>
* Description:
* </p>
* <p>
* Copyright: Copyright (c) 2008
* </p>
* <p>
* Company: LoonFramework
* </p>
* <p>
* License: [url]http://www.apache.org/licenses/LICENSE-2.0 [/url]
* </p>
*
* @author chenpeng
* @email:[email protected]
* @version 0.1
*/
class Timer implements Runnable {
Pacgame ap;
int duration;
private Thread myThread;
private boolean loopf = true;
private long tickCount;
public Timer(Pacgame ap, int duration) {
this.ap = ap;
this.duration = duration;
}
public Timer(Pacgame ap) {
this(ap, 16);
}
public void on() {
myThread = new Thread(this);
myThread.start();
}
public void off() {
loopf = false;
}
public void run() {
loopf = true;
tickCount = System.currentTimeMillis();
while (loopf) {
try {
Thread.sleep(duration);
} catch (Exception e) {
e.printStackTrace();
}
ap.notifyFrame ();
}
}
public int frames() {
long nowTick = System.currentTimeMillis();
int frame = (int) (nowTick - tickCount) / duration;
if (frame <= 0) {
frame = 1;
tickCount = nowTick;
} else if (frame > 5) {
frame = 5;
tickCount = nowTick;
} else {
tickCount += frame * duration;
}
return frame;
}
}
public class Pacgame extends Panel implements Runnable {
/** *//**
*
*/
private static final long serialVersionUID = 1L;
private static int WIDTH = 256;
private static int HEIGHT = 224;
Thread thread;
//構造一個雙緩沖的、可變的image
VolatileImage offImage;
Image bg, bg0;
CGloader loader;
MazeManager mzmanager;
MapManager emanager;
SpriteManager spmanager, chipmanager;
MonsterSprite redmon, ao, pink, monster;
PacSprite pac;
AttractManager atMng;
Timer timer;
int key = 0;
int score;
int number1;
boolean loadOK = false;
boolean isAttr = false;
public void init() {
ClassLoader cl = getClass().getClassLoader();
Toolkit tk = Toolkit.getDefaultToolkit();
bg0 = tk.createImage(cl.getResource("main.png"));
bg = new BufferedImage(WIDTH, HEIGHT, BufferedImage.TYPE_INT_ARGB_PRE);
MediaTracker mt = new MediaTracker(this);
mt.addImage(bg0, 0);
try {
mt.waitForID(0);
} catch (Exception e) {
e.printStackTrace();
}
loader = new CGloader("pacchr.png", this);
loader.setAlpha(0, 8);
mzmanager = new MazeManager();
emanager = new MapManager();
spmanager = new SpriteManager(4);
chipmanager = new SpriteManager(5);
pac = new PacSprite(10, 20, loader);
redmon = new RedMonster(10, 10, mzmanager, loader);
redmon.setTarget(pac);
spmanager.add(redmon);
ao = new BlueMonster(9, 13, mzmanager, loader);
ao.setTarget(pac);
spmanager.add(ao);
pink = new PinkMonster(10, 13, mzmanager, loader);
pink.setTarget(pac);
spmanager.add(pink);
monster = new Monster(11, 13, mzmanager, loader);
monster.setTarget(pac);
spmanager.add(monster);
for (int i = 0; i < 5; i++) {
chipmanager.add(new ChipSprite(i * 16, 0, loader, i * 16, 130, 16,
16));
}
atMng = new AttractManager(loader);
timer = new Timer(this, 16);
setBackground(Color.black);
setSize(WIDTH, HEIGHT);
offImage = createVolatileImage(WIDTH, HEIGHT);
}
public void paint(Graphics g) {
if (! loadOK)
return;
do {
int returnCode = offImage.validate(getGraphicsConfiguration());
if (returnCode == VolatileImage.IMAGE_INCOMPATIBLE){
offImage = createVolatileImage(WIDTH, HEIGHT);
}
Graphics volG = offImage.getGraphics();
volG.drawImage (bg, 0, 0, this);
spmanager.draw(volG, this);
pac.draw(volG, this);
chipmanager.draw(volG, this);
if (isAttr)
atMng.draw(volG, this);
volG.dispose();
g.drawImage (offImage, 0, 0, this);
} while (offImage.contentsLost());
}
public void update(Graphics g) {
paint(g);
}
public void start() {
System.gc();
if (thread == null) {
thread = new Thread(this);
thread.start();
}
}
@SuppressWarnings ("deprecation")
public void stop() {
if (thread != null) {
thread.stop();
thread = null;
}
}
public void run() {
while (true) {
// MAIN LOOP
score = 0;
number1 = 3;
int stage = 1;
esaInit();
loadOK = true;
while (number1 > 0) {
while (gameMain(stage) == 2) {
if (stage == 2)
gameTheater();
stage++;
number1++;// 1:DEAD 2:CLEAR
esaInit();
}
}
// GAME OVER
isAttr = true;
spmanager.setShow(false);
pac.setShow (false);
atMng.player = true;
atMng.ready = false;
atMng.gameover = true;
repaint();
timer.on();
key = 0;
while (true) {
if (key > 0)
break;
waitFrame();
}
timer.off();
atMng.player = false;
atMng.gameover = false;
}
}
public void esaInit() {
Graphics g = bg.getGraphics();
g.drawImage(bg0, 0, 0, null);
g.dispose();
emanager.init(bg);
}
public int gameMain(int stage) {
atMng.init(bg, score, number1);
spmanager.init();
pac.init();
// 游戲狀態 1:DEAD 2:CLEAR
int gamestat = 0;
int renzoku = 0;
boolean ispower = false;
boolean iseyesnd = false;
Sprite chip;
isAttr = true;
int wait;
if ((score == 0) && (number1 == 3)) {
wait = 2000;
} else {
wait = 1000;
}
spmanager.setShow(false);
pac.setShow(false);
atMng.player = true;
atMng.ready = true;
repaint();
sleep(wait);
atMng.setBattle(-- number1);
spmanager.setShow(true);
pac.setShow (true);
atMng.player = false;
atMng.ready = true;
repaint();
sleep(wait);
isAttr = false;
int time = 0;
timer.on();
int frame = 1;
while (gamestat == 0) {
for (int l = 0; l < frame; l++) {
int score0 = score;
if (time == 60 * 55) {
spmanager.setNawabari(false);
} else if (time == 60 * 50) {
spmanager.setNawabari(true);
} else if (time == 60 * 30) {
spmanager.setNawabari(false);
} else if (time == 60 * 25) {
spmanager.setNawabari(true);
} else if (time == 60 * 5) {
spmanager.setNawabari(false);
}
spmanager.run();
MonsterSprite hitmon = spmanager.isMonsterHit(pac);
if (hitmon != null) {
int state = hitmon.getState();
if (state == 0)
gamestat = 1;
if (state == 1) {
renzoku++;
score = score + (1 << renzoku) * 100;
chip = chipmanager.getSprite(renzoku);
int x = hitmon.getX();
int y = hitmon.getY();
chip.setXY(x, y);
chip.setShow(true);
hitmon.setShow(false);
pac.setShow(false);
try {
Thread.sleep(50);
} catch (Exception e) {
}
repaint();
for (int i = 0; i < 50; i++) {
try {
Thread.sleep(10);
} catch (Exception e) {
}
}
chip.setShow(false);
hitmon.setShow (true);
pac.setShow(true);
hitmon.activity();
iseyesnd = true;
if (ispower) {
if (iseyesnd)
try {
Thread.sleep(10);
} catch (Exception e) {
}
}
}
}
pac.setKey(key);
int esa = pac.run(mzmanager, emanager);
if (esa > 0) {
int remain = emanager.getRemain();
score += 10;
if (remain <= 0)
gamestat = 2;
}
if (esa == 2) {
redmon.state();
ao.state();
pink.state();
monster.state();
pac.powerup();
renzoku = 0;
score += 40;
ispower = true;
}
if (ispower) {
if (!pac.isPower()
|| ((redmon.getState() != 1)
&& (ao.getState() != 1)
&& (pink.getState() != 1) && (monster
.getState() != 1))) {
ispower = false;
}
}
if (iseyesnd) {
if ((redmon.getState() != 2) && (ao.getState() != 2)
&& (pink.getState() != 2)
&& (monster.getState() != 2)) {
iseyesnd = false;
}
}
if (score != score0) {
atMng.setScore(score);
}
time++;
score0 = score;
if (gamestat > 0)
break;
} // FPS LOOP END
repaint();
frame = waitFrame();
System.gc();
}
timer.off();
try {
Thread.sleep (2000);
} catch (Exception e) {
}
return gamestat;
}
public void gameTheater() {
Graphics g = bg.getGraphics();
g.setColor(Color.black);
g.fillRect(0, 0, WIDTH, HEIGHT);
g.dispose();
int pacx = WIDTH;
int p;
int index = 288;
spmanager.setShow(false);
pac.init();
pac.setShow (true);
redmon.init();
redmon.setShow(true);
timer.on();
int frame = 1;
int i = 0;
while (i < 380) {
for (int j = 0; j < frame; j++) {
p = 2;
switch ((i >> 2) % 4) {
case 1:
p += 4;
break;
case 3:
p = 8;
break;
}
pac.setP(p);
pac.setXY(pacx--, 100);
redmon.setXY(index--, 100);
i++;
if (i >= 360)
break;
}
repaint();
frame = waitFrame();
}
pacx = -32;
redmon.state();
index = 0;
i = 0;
while (i < 380) {
for (int j = 0; j < frame; j++) {
p = 0;
switch ((i >> 2) % 4) {
case 1:
p += 4;
break;
case 3:
p = 8;
break;
}
pac.setP(p);
pac.setXY(pacx++, 100);
redmon.setXY(index++, 100);
i++;
if (i >= 360)
break;
}
repaint();
frame = waitFrame();
}
timer.off();
}
public void sleep(int tm) {
try {
Thread.sleep(tm);
} catch (Exception e) {
e.printStackTrace();
}
}
public boolean handleEvent(Event e) {
switch (e.id) {
case Event.KEY_PRESS:
case Event.KEY_ACTION:
switch (e.key) {
case Event.RIGHT:
key = 1;
break;
case Event.DOWN:
key = 2;
break;
case Event.LEFT:
key = 4;
break;
case Event.UP:
key = 8;
break;
}
return true;
case Event.KEY_RELEASE:
case Event.KEY_ACTION_RELEASE:
default:
}
return false;
}
/** *//**
* fps計算
*
* @return
*/
private synchronized int waitFrame() {
try {
wait();
} catch (InterruptedException e) {
}
// 返回fps
return timer.frames();
}
public synchronized final void notifyFrame() {
notifyAll();
}
public static void main(String[] args) {
final Pacgame ap = new Pacgame();
ap.setSize(WIDTH, HEIGHT);
Frame frm = new Frame("Java吃豆游戲");
frm.addWindowListener(new WindowAdapter () {
public void windowClosing(WindowEvent e) {
ap.stop();
System.exit(0);
}
});
frm.addNotify();
Insets inset = frm.getInsets();
int w0 = inset.left + inset.right;
int h0 = inset.top + inset.bottom;
frm.add(ap);
frm.setSize(ap.getWidth() + w0, ap.getHeight() + h0);
frm.setResizable(false);
frm.setLocationRelativeTo(null);
frm.setVisible(true);
ap.requestFocus();
ap.init ();
ap.start();
}
}
